- 博客(10)
- 资源 (2)
- 收藏
- 关注
原创 供料车间用电分析
1.能源管理仪表电量declare @times date = '2020-06-10'DECLARE @month DATE = CONVERT(DATE,CONVERT(VARCHAR(8),@times,120)+'01',120)DECLARE @last_day DATE = DATEADD(d,-1,@month)DECLARE @last_month DATE = CONVERT(DATE,CONVERT(VARCHAR(8),@last_day,120)+'01',120)DE
2020-06-10 16:53:07 191
原创 Hibernate框架学习笔记
1.Hibernate 是什么Hibernate属于ORM (Object Relative Mapping)最顶级的框架,完全面向对象操作数据库。ORM框架分为四级DBUtils 是第一级,最初级的ORM,只能封装一下结果集。Mybatis是第二级。2.Hibernate 的框架搭建1.导包需要导入mysql驱动包 还有 Hibernate 的 核心jar包。2....
2019-06-05 17:06:49 121
原创 hdu ---- Just a Hook
题目链接错误找了三个小时 ,原因建树的时候。。。 tag没有初始化,,,当场暴毙~~~,,,啊啊啊啊啊 我才想起来是多组数据。。因为我记得结构体中的数是默认为0的 但是我忘了初始化tag。。。emm 一定要养成随手初始化的好习惯。。。呜呜呜呜。。。#include<bits/stdc++.h>using namespace std;const int maxn = 1e5...
2019-05-22 11:24:58 85
原创 Contest Hunter 4301 Can you answer on these queries III
记住建树的时候赋值的节点是cnt节点,查询的时候返回的也是cnt的值 因为没有区间修改所以不用Lazy标记。。。记录下自己犯下的低级错误,。。#include<bits/stdc++.h>using namespace std;#define lson cnt<<1#define rson cnt<<1|1const int maxn = 5e...
2019-05-21 20:53:34 117
原创 Educational Codeforces Round 65 (Rated for Div. 2)
题目链接A. Telephone Number题目大意:给你一串数字,看能不能通过删除某些数字从而使这串数字变成一个电话号码。对电话号码的定义为8开头,长度为11位。解题思路:找第一个8出现的位置,看到最后的长度有没有11位,如果有的话就输出YES,没有就输出NO。#include<bits/stdc++.h>using namespace std;int mai...
2019-05-19 20:53:33 145
原创 Codeforces Round #560 (Div. 3)
题目链接A. Remainder题意就是给你一个n位数,让你求对取模的余数是次方需要操作多少次。每一次可以吧任意一位上的0变成1,1变成0。解题思路: 求一下x后面有多少个1就好了。不算第y位。当第y位为1的情况下,需要操作的次数为x后面的1的个数,如果第y位为0,操作次数+1即可。#include<bits/stdc++.h>using namespace std...
2019-05-18 20:51:00 176
原创 蓝桥杯--城市建设
题目链接题目大概意思就是说有n个点 m条边。如果只是这样的话就是最小生成树的裸体 (裸题)。但是他还有一个东西。码头。就是有些地方可以建码头,建码头的各个点之间可以相互到达。问求最小的花费。注意可以是负数这个条件。思路:就是最小生成树的变形题了,因为有的地方不可以建码头,我们可以虚拟出来一个点0,可以建码头的点就相当于和0建立了一条边,权值为建码头所需要的费用。这样的话我们就可以按照最小生...
2019-05-18 17:08:11 201
原创 蓝桥杯--连号区间和
题目描述n 个小朋友站成一排。现在要把他们按身高从低到高的顺序排列,但是每次只能交换位置相邻的两个小朋友。每个小朋友都有一个不高兴的程度。开始的时候,所有小朋友的不高兴程度都是0。如果某个小朋友第一次被要求交换,则他的不高兴程度增加1,如果第二次要求他交换,则他的不高兴程度增加2(即不高兴程度为3),依次类推。当要求某个小朋友第k次交换时,他的不高兴程度增加k。请问,要让所有小朋...
2019-05-15 11:13:23 102
原创 蓝桥杯-最大矩阵
题目意思就是说给你一个n*m的矩阵,让你求出最大的子矩阵和。看了一下数据范围 好大。。。不过O()还是过了。。hh...。刚开始还脑can写了个dp,没写对。(为自己的智商感到担忧。。)正确思路:对每一行进行一个前缀和 sum[i][j] 表示 第i行前j个数的和。然后进行三层for循环 。第一层循环的是从第i列开始,第二层循环的是到第j列结束,第三层循环的是前k行。注意初始化最大值为s...
2019-05-15 10:43:43 202
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人